WebApr 14, 2024 · which allows us to build a connection between k F and r s. Finally, the ratio between kinetic energy and interaction energy is. (10) E i n t E k ∝ e 2 / r s 1 / m r s 2 = r s a 0. Here a 0 = 1 m e 2 = 0.529 Angstrom. When r s ≫ a 0 (low density), we have a strongly correlated system with the energy of interactions greater than kinetic energy.

SMART … grass seed for livestockWebTypically, strongly correlated materials have incompletely filled d - or f - electron shells with narrow energy bands. One can no longer consider any electron in the material as being in a "sea" of the averaged motion of the others (also known as mean field theory ).
